Title: Adding Jump Points to a System?
Post by: GhostOfGod on April 06, 2012, 06:09:51 PM
I've been dabbling in system creation to create some mineral rich systems between myself and NPRs with the intention of fighting over them. However I'm not able to add any new JPs to a system despite my best efforts. I realize that I could re-route existing JPs to point where I want them too, but that's beside the point.

This issue also arises in cases where I want to create a non-Sol home-system and I get only 1 or 2 JPs, which may or may not leave me completely isolated from the rest of the 'verse.

The process I'm following is this:
1) Select SM race as default race (for sol system creation at least)
2) Go to the System Generation and Display menu (F9)
3) Create a new system
4) Click "Jump Points" Tab
5) Click "Add JP" Button.

I pondered putting this under Bugs, but I think I'm doing something wrong rather than the game. Anyone know?

Post by: Erik L on April 06, 2012, 08:08:26 PM
If you are putting them in the system with the SM race, your player race would need to survey for them.

You can stay with your race selected and in SM Mode just add a new JP too.

Surveying for them is fine, in fact that's what I was expecting to do....wait a minute.

Alrighty, figured it out. It was user error, this tipped me off.
If you are putting them in the system with the SM race, your player race would need to survey for them.
While that wasn't directly the problem, it was close. Turns out that while SM mode will let you see the JPs in a newly created system without surveying it, it won't show you any that you add without surveying. Strange.
